Yering Station Cabernet Sauvignon - 2010
Yarra Valley, Victoria

Varietal Cabernet Sauvignon
Closure Screw Cap Size 750ml
Alc/Vol 14.5% Enjoy Now - 2018
Deep rich red colour. The nose boasts of sweet blackcurrant, mulberry, chocolate, mocha and cedary oak.
Medium to full bodied, the palate is fruit forward with rich blackcurrant and cassis. Overlayed with sweet raspberries and violet undertones. The mid palate is round and supple, the tannins are fine and ripe. Intensity and concentration only found in exceptional years.
The Cabernet Sauvignon was de-stemmed and crushed into open stainless steel fermenters, roto-fermenters or closed fermenters. Extended maceration for 28 days of some selected parcels to improve tannic structure. Hand plunged and ‘rack and return’ methods of cap management allow gentle extraction of fine grain tannins whilst providing fruit concentration. 15 months in french oak adds supporting spicy, vanillan oak.
